Plastic Drinkware?

My reception venue is a large outdoor garden that specializes in koi.  They don't want glass beer and wine glasses possibly being dropped into the dozens of koi ponds they have scattered through the grounds (koi are expensive and glass can easily kill them).  I'd like the look of glass and am OK with buying some glasses, but don't want to spend more than a dollar or so per glass.    Basically, I just don't want anything to look or feel cheap.  

Is this very common?  I've googled plastic glasses, but can't find anything that's in between fairly expensive (permanent crappy restaurant drinkware) and cheap (new years eve party for 100).

  • I spent some time worrying about what type of glassware to use myself.  I was afraid things would look too cheap, but then I realized my guests won't be there to criticize the plates or cups - they're coming to watch FI and I get married and to have a good time.  We decided to purchase plastic cups (Solo brand, for example) to match our wedding colors, and we're just going with that.  Our reception isn't super formal, but it's a buffet dinner.  The caterer is providing plastic silverware and paper plates.  And like it was mentioned above, plastic is easy cleanup :)  But then too, it's a matter of your personal style.  If you don't feel right just having the el cheapo plastic cups, then by all means, do what's right for you.  I've seen some nicer looking plastic cups at several party stores (Factory Card Outlet, Party Source/Party Town).  There are some good websites too - OrientalTrading.com, FlowerFactory.com, MyPaperShop.com... hope that helps and good luck with your planning!
  • We bought plastic glasses for our wedding, we went to BJ's (its like a sams club) they had these wonderful square shaped glasses, nice sized and in the words of my fiance the will hold a double jack and coke plus ice!  they were 30 for $6, and then we went to the dollar store and got the wine glasses (plastic ones) they were 6 for $1 and they look nice and are sturdy.  In our mind well worth it!
